Section 356: Opinion of Board of doctors

The Rajasthan Prisons Rules, 2022State Rules of Rajasthan · 1894

If a mentally ill prisoner undergoing trial in a criminal case is certified by a board of doctors constituted for the purpose with the permission of the Court, that in their opinion such person is capable of making his or her defence, he or she shall be taken before the Magistrate or court, as the case may be, at such time as the Magistrate or court appoints for undergoing trial in the case against him.
